📌  相关文章
📜  如果单元格为空白 (1)

📅  最后修改于: 2023-12-03 15:09:19.144000             🧑  作者: Mango

如果单元格为空白

在编程中,经常需要检查电子表格中的单元格是否为空白。本文介绍了几种用于检查空白单元格的方法,以及如何在不同编程语言中使用这些方法。

方法一:检查单元格值是否为null或undefined

在大多数编程语言中,可以使用null或undefined值来表示空白的单元格。因此,我们可以使用以下代码来检查单元格是否为空白:

if (cellValue === null || cellValue === undefined) {
  // 单元格是空白的
} else {
  // 单元格不是空白的
}

在这个代码片段中,cellValue是要检查的单元格的值。如果它等于null或undefined,那么单元格就是空白的。

方法二:检查单元格值是否为空字符串

另一种检查空白单元格的方法是检查其值是否为空字符串。某些编程语言(如JavaScript)将空字符串视为false,因此我们可以使用以下代码来检查单元格是否为空白:

if (!cellValue.trim()) {
  // 单元格是空白的
} else {
  // 单元格不是空白的
}

在这个代码片段中,trim()函数删除字符串前面和后面的空格。如果单元格值是一个空字符串(即不包含任何字符),那么trim()函数将返回一个空字符串,!运算符将其转换为true。因此,如果单元格值是一个空白字符串,那么!cellValue.trim()将返回true,我们将进入if语句块。

方法三:检查单元格是否具有长度或大小

最后一种用于检查空白单元格的方法是检查其是否具有长度或大小。在某些编程语言中,例如Java,空字符串的长度为0。我们可以使用以下代码来检查单元格是否为空白:

if (cellValue.length() == 0) {
  // 单元格是空白的
} else {
  // 单元格不是空白的
}

在这个代码片段中,cellValue是要检查的单元格的值。如果它的长度为0,那么单元格就是空白的。

以上是三种检查电子表格中空白单元格的方法。根据编程语言不同,可以使用其中任意一种或多种进行检查。切记,对于使用以上方法进行检查的情况,请务必根据电子表格中单元格的具体情况进行测试。